UNPKG

kero

Version:

<img src="http://tinper.org/assets/images/kero.png" width="120" style="max-width:100%;"/>

64 lines (58 loc) 2.49 kB
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>Title</title> <link rel="stylesheet" href="//design.yonyoucloud.com/static/uploader/css/webuploader.css"> <link rel="stylesheet" href="//design.yonyoucloud.com/static/uui/latest/css/font-awesome.css"> <link rel="stylesheet" type="text/css" href="//design.yonyoucloud.com/static/uui/latest/css/u.css"> <link rel="stylesheet" type="text/css" href="//design.yonyoucloud.com/static/uui/latest/css/tree.css"> <link rel="stylesheet" type="text/css" href="//design.yonyoucloud.com/static/uui/latest/css/grid.css"> <style id="demo-style" media="screen"> </style> </head> <body style="background-color: #eceff1;margin-left: 20px;width: calc(100% - 20px );"> <!-- HTML u-meta:框架特有标记,框架通过识别此标记创建对应UI组件,以及进行数据绑定 id,type.data,field为必选项 id:创建组件唯一标识 type:创建组件对应的类型 data:指定数据模型中的数据集 field:绑定数据集中对应的字段 --> <div class="u-form-group"> <label>验证测试用例</label> <div class="u-input-group u-has-feedback" u-meta='{"id":"f1field","type":"string","data":"dt1","field":"f1"}'> <div class="u-input-group-before" style="color: red;">*</div> <input type="text" class="u-form-control"> </div> </div> <script src="//design.yonyoucloud.com/static/jquery/jquery-1.11.2.js"></script> <script src="//design.yonyoucloud.com/static/uploader/js/webuploader.js"></script> <script src="//design.yonyoucloud.com/static/knockout/knockout-3.2.0.debug.js"></script> <script src="//design.yonyoucloud.com/static/uui/latest/js/u-polyfill.js"></script> <script src="//design.yonyoucloud.com/static/uui/latest/js/u.js"></script> <script src="//design.yonyoucloud.com/static/uui/latest/js/u-tree.js"></script> <script src="//design.yonyoucloud.com/static/uui/latest/js/u-grid.js"></script> <script src="//design.yonyoucloud.com/static/requirejs/require.debug.js"></script> <script> // JS var app,viewModel; viewModel = { dt1: new u.DataTable({ meta:{ f1:{type:'string',required:true,maxLength:8,minLength:3}, f2:{type:'string',required:true,maxLength:8,minLength:3,notipFlag: true, hasSuccess: true}, } }) }; app = u.createApp({ el:'body', model:viewModel }); var r = viewModel.dt1.createEmptyRow();</script> </body> </html>